2019-2025
CTO & Technical Architect
Teamecho.
Linz, Austria
First time at a startup
Teamecho is a SaaS platform for collecting and analyzing employee feedback. I started as the first engineer and took over the development responsibilities from a contractor. In the following years, we built up our in-house software development and operations team. Key responsibilities Development and operation of the Teamecho SaaS product Responsible technical architect for the backend Developing the product roadmap together with the CEOs and product management Lead the technical development of the product Developer productivity engineering Key achievements Established software architecture to support the growing number of features Established development, deployment, monitoring, operations, and tech support workflows to support the company’s scaling of the business. Migrated the application to the cloud (Microsoft Azure) Integrated AI Technologies into the product (custom models and 3rd party services) Hired and developed the current engineering team Tech stack Backend: Spring Boot, OpenApi, Kotlin, Java Frontend: TypeScript, React, Redux, RTK, SCSS Data storage: JPA/Hibernate, Flyway, MySQL, MongoDB, Redis Testing: JUnit, Mockito, JaCoCo, Jest, Cypress Build and Deployment: Gradle, npm, Docker, GitLab CI, Microsoft Azure (using Bicep templates) Development Environment: IntelliJ IDEA, Visual Studio Code, GitLab Monitoring: Azure Application Insights, Grafana Code quality tools: detekt, checkstyle, esLint, Sonar, ArchUnit
2014-2019
Software Developer & Team Lead
Cloudflight.
Linz, Austria
First long-term job
Cloudflight is a software development company specializing in enterprise solutions and digital transformation services. I was a team and project leader within the Emerging Technologies segment working in distributed teams. Many of the projects I worked on had one or more data analysis or machine learning components providing services to enterprise applications. Two projects are listed below. Key responsibilities Designed and implemented enterprise software solutions Analyzed customer requirements Performed data analytics and machine learning in the media, industrial, and retail sectors Contributed to the development of digital agendas for AI topics such as predictive maintenance or natural language processing Conducted candidate interviews and represented the company at career fairs Project: Newsadoo Newsadoo is a news aggregator that uses AI to aggregate news articles by topic to create a personalized news experience. My team at Cloudflight supported Newsadoo in its early stages. Led the technical development of the product and prepared Newsadoo to take back control Implemented the first user-interest based news timeline algorithm Re-implemented the critical endpoints to meet modern web applications performance and security standards Isolated the main application database from other microservices and switched communication to message queues. Moved from an AWS Elastic Beanstalk deployment to a containerized deployment using AWS Fargate. Technologies I used: Spring Boot, Kotlin, Java, Liquibase, Postgres, JUnit, Mockito, Gradle, npm, Docker, Teamcity, AWS (Cloudformation templates), IntelliJ IDEA, GitLab, checkstyle, Sonar, Prometheus, Grafna Project: Data Analysis for Steel Casting Developed a data analysis platform to manage and analyze temperature measurements during the cooling process.
